LM5175: Different SoftStart depending on CSLOPE value

Part Number: LM5175

(1) SoftStart is not enough when CSLOPE is 33pF.

On the other hand, Softstart is normal when CSLOPE is 82pF.

I'd like to know the reason why the operation differs depending on the value of Cslope.

Actually the trend seems to be opposite, because smaller CSLOPE capacitor will create higher voltage at the PWM comparator during startup, which slows down the duty cycle growth and leader to longer soft start. The issue here seems to be related to a too small CSLOPE capacitor which produces too high slope signal which internally may be clipped, then the PWM comparator compares two flat top signal instead of one flat (COMP) and one ramp (CS + SLOPE), and the duty cycle can become large. If you compare 82pF and 150pF, you should see the SS with 150pF could be slightly slower at the beginning of the soft start.
